Understanding Visa Options

How do business owners manage the complicated terrain of visa options when looking to recruit foreign talent? Engaging an immigration lawyer can streamline this process, offering proficiency in various visa categories, such as H-1B for specialty occupations or L-1 for intra-company transfers. The legal professional can review each candidate's background and pair them with the right visa category, guaranteeing adherence to immigration regulations. Additionally, they can shed light on less common visas, like O-1 visas designed for individuals with exceptional talents, expanding the range of available candidates. By clarifying eligibility requirements and potential pitfalls, an immigration lawyer makes decision-making more straightforward, allowing business owners to focus on strategic growth and innovation while effectively incorporating international talent into their teams.

Important Steps for Achieving Compliance With Immigration Regulations

Ensuring adherence to immigration requirements is critical for employers aiming to maintain a compliant and productive staff. The primary measure involves comprehending the particular visa conditions applicable to their business sector and staffing requirements. Companies must carry out detailed evaluations to identify which staff members must obtain employment authorization and the suitable visa classifications.

Next, companies should develop structured procedures for documenting staff eligibility, including processing the I-9 form for all new hires. Routine audits of staff records can reveal compliance shortfalls and minimize risks.

Moreover, staying informed about updates to immigration laws is crucial, as policies may regularly shift. Consulting an immigration attorney can deliver expert advice on addressing these legal complexities.

Ultimately, fostering a compliance-oriented culture within the organization assures that all employees are informed about their responsibilities regarding immigration compliance, which leads to a more secure and productive business environment.

Common Questions and Answers

How Much Do You Usually Pay to Hire an Immigration Lawyer?

Hiring an immigration lawyer generally runs anywhere from $100 to $500 per hour, based on the attorney's level of experience and specialization. Flat fees for specific services can vary from $1,000 to $5,000, varying by case complexity.
